NOTES: Not much today. Toronto manager John Gibbons put all his left-handed sticks in the lineup today to face Silva, who has been hit at a .314 clip by lefties this season. … After the off-day on Thursday, the Jays plan on simply bumping their rotation back one day for each pitcher. So Josh Towers will take the ball on Friday and Roy Halladay on Saturday. Towers won’t be skipped, considering his regular turn falls on Thursday.

I spent some time taking a look at the club hitting stats for both last year and this year to date. Baseball is always a game of averages and statistics, since the teams play 162 games a year.
Item 2006 2007
BA .284 .260
RBI’s 4.8/G 4.55/g
Hr’s 1.23/g 1.16/g
2base 2.15/g 2.05/g
runs 4.99/g 4.73/g
The lower team ba has likely lead to the decline of the other numbers. However, when you look at the lineup this year versus 2006, you would assume the 2007 numbers would be better than 2006, since we added Thomas.
So, either we will see the team over perform in the next 61 games or we have a lot of players that are going to have an off year all at the same time. The odds of that happening is slim, and of course being the eternal optimist that I am, I prefer to think, we will over perform in the last 61 games to bring us closer to the game averages we had last year.
That being said, it could mean a strong finish to the season for the Jays, since to reach last years levels in the next 61 games, we’d likely have to overperform the to date numbers by 15%-20% per game-if that makes sense to you. An example would be runs per game, where to match last years total number, we’d have to produce an average of 5.43 runs oer game versus the 4.73 we’ve been averaging.
The next 4-5 weeks, we have afavorable schedule, so we could get right back into the race by the end of August.
